WebbAmong the bird world’s most skillful fliers, Cooper’s Hawks are common woodland hawks that tear through cluttered tree canopies in high speed pursuit of other birds. You’re most likely to see one prowling above a forest edge or field using just a few stiff wingbeats followed by a glide. WebbThe Red-Tailed Hawk is the second largest hawk in north America. As the name suggests they have a red tail and white feathered bellies. Red-Tailed Hawks are solitary birds and habituate in the open country, often perching on lone trees. The Red-Tailed Hawk has a scream that sounds very familiar to the distinct raptor screams in Hollywood movies.

WebbSharp-shinned Hawks are the smallest hawks in Canada, and they are incredibly athletic and acrobatic. It’s common to see these raptors zipping through the woods or by your bird feeders in a blur of motion!. To identify these birds, look for bars of orange on their upper chest that fades towards the belly and blue-gray back and wings.
